Output 70e345f69e5f2d12bb2b631d4a32dcb7c8dcf500012623a500a3276140e29508:11

value
53855015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c84214579b24bc317bb17362973bd229895d477d OP_EQUAL
address
MSA2Y5TrgfTZVBaH26r6dKUjHWM9FUiaDx
transaction
70e345f69e5f2d12bb2b631d4a32dcb7c8dcf500012623a500a3276140e29508
spent
true